Consider the Material
Perhaps the single most important consideration in a bathroom wall panel is what it’s made of. This can be seen as a positive thing in that you may have different advantages of material but also means there are other things to keep in mind.
PVC Panels: P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ride) is a Lightweight, easy installation and ANSI style and finish options. PVC panels are also simple to clean, which makes them perfect for busy families. By contrast, they might not provide the degree of luxury some materials do.
Acrylic Panels: They are available in a shiny finish and can keep your bathroom warm. Aluminium or acrylic panels would be simple to install, and could easily be cut to fit the chosen area. This material is a little pricier than PVC, but it comes with an extra sense of style.
Laminate Panels: These panels have all the design possibilities and can appear like wood, stone, or tiles. They are more challenging to install but they have a durable water-resistant category. With their appearance in mind, laminate panels are good if you want the same look of a natural material but without having to pay very much for it.
Choose the Right Style
The pattern of the tiles on your bathroom wall should piece together fashionably with that of the overall theme of your abode. Popular Styles to Look for and My Top Pick
Tile Effect Panels: Get a stylish look without having to worry about grout with these panels mimicking traditional tiles. Available in several patterns and colors they offer all of the classic tile appeal, with easier upkeep.
Stone Effect: Want to Give the Space a Natural, Luxury Finish? They mimic how marble, granite, or slate look and add an elegant touch to your bathroom.
High-Gloss Panels: Perfect for a modern as well as stylish look; they reflect light which would make small bathrooms look bigger and airier. These are available in many colors to perfectly fit any design.
